You bought an e-bike to make life easier, but that doesn't mean it's maintenance-free. While the motor does a lot of the work, your e-bike still relies on the simple, mechanical parts that all bikes use. And if those parts aren't working smoothly, they're creating drag—and forcing your motor to work harder.

The truth is, a well-maintained e-bike is a more efficient e-bike, and that efficiency translates directly into more miles per charge. By adopting a few simple maintenance habits, you're not just taking care of your bike; you're protecting its most valuable asset: its range.

The Drivetrain: The Heart of Your Efficiency

Your drivetrain—the chain, cassette (gears), and chainring—is the system that transfers your pedal power to the rear wheel. When it's dirty, it's a huge energy waster.

  • Friction is the Enemy: A grimy, gritty, or dry chain creates friction. This friction acts like a constant, invisible brake on your bike. To overcome it, your motor has to draw more power just to keep you moving, especially when you're accelerating or climbing a hill.
  • The Result: The more friction you have, the less of your battery's energy is converted into forward motion. A clean, well-lubricated drivetrain allows your bike to glide, letting the motor run at its most efficient level and giving you more miles for your effort.

Your Action Plan:

  • Clean It: After a few rides, especially in wet or dusty conditions, take a few minutes to clean your chain with a degreaser. A simple chain-cleaning tool or a good brush can get the job done in minutes.
  • Lube It: Once the chain is dry, apply a good quality bike-specific lubricant. This protects the chain from wear and tear and keeps everything running smoothly.

Brakes & Bearings: The Hidden Drags

While a clean drivetrain is important, other parts of your bike can also be silently robbing your range.

  • Dragging Brakes: If your brake pads are rubbing against your wheel rim or rotor, you're creating constant friction. It may be so subtle that you don't even feel it, but your motor definitely feels it and has to work harder to overcome the drag.
  • Worn-Out Bearings: Your wheels, bottom bracket, and pedals all spin on bearings. Over time, these can get gritty or stiff. If a bearing isn't spinning freely, it’s adding more resistance to your ride.

Your Action Plan:

  • The Lift Test: A simple way to check for dragging brakes is to lift your bike and spin the wheels. They should spin freely for a good amount of time with no scraping or rubbing sounds. If you hear a noise or if the wheel stops quickly, you may need a simple brake adjustment.
  • The Spin Test: Spin your pedals by hand. They should spin smoothly and easily. If they feel crunchy or stiff, it might be time for a professional check-up.

The Quick-Check Routine

Making a habit of these simple maintenance checks before every ride can save you from a lot of unnecessary battery drain.

  • The Tire Pressure Test: An under-inflated tire is one of the biggest sources of rolling resistance. A quick squeeze or a check with a pressure gauge before a ride ensures your tires are ready to go.
  • The Visual Scan: A quick visual check of your bike can reveal a lot. Look for a clean chain, no visible damage, and a properly aligned wheel.

A little preventative maintenance goes a long way. By keeping your e-bike clean and well-tuned, you are ensuring that all the power from your battery is converted into forward motion, giving you the maximum range possible. It's the easiest way to get more out of your ride and keep your e-bike running smoothly for years to come.
